The clack of metal against metal rings through this capture, turning everyday dining equipment into dynamic audio detail. The hand‑held blade presses against a stubborn tin lid, generating a series of sharp clicks followed by a steady rasp as the edge rolls around the circumference. Just before release, a sudden metallic snap punctuates the action, adding an audible cue of completion that echoes the tactile satisfaction of a well‑timed opener.

Audio engineers appreciate the careful layering in this take—the initial contact is crisp yet warm, offering enough depth to suggest proximity without drowning other sounds. As the blade moves, subtle changes in timbre trace the motion, providing an invisible visual guide for mixers. In close‑up mixes, the click retains its bite; in mid‑field applications it offers a gentle percussive backdrop that still registers under a soundtrack without overpowering dialogue.
